在当今数据驱动的商业环境中,可视化数据看板已经成为企业决策和业务监控的"神经中枢"。我曾为多家上市公司搭建过数据看板系统,最深刻的体会是:一个优秀的数据看板不是图表的堆砌,而是业务逻辑的视觉化表达。它能将复杂的数据关系转化为直观的视觉信号,帮助决策者在3秒内抓住关键信息。
传统的数据汇报方式存在三个致命缺陷:首先是信息碎片化,Excel表格和PPT报告往往割裂了数据间的关联;其次是响应滞后,静态报告无法实时反映业务变化;最重要的是认知负荷高,非技术人员需要花费大量时间解读原始数据。而专业的数据看板通过以下方式解决这些问题:
根据我的项目经验,数据看板主要服务于三类场景:
战略决策场景:面向高管层,聚焦企业级KPI(如营收增长率、市场份额)。某零售客户案例中,我们设计的"战略仪表盘"将12个核心指标浓缩在1屏内,通过"交通灯"系统直观显示各区域达标状态,董事会每月节省约40%的数据讨论时间。
运营监控场景:用于业务部门日常管理,强调过程指标。例如电商运营看板通常包含流量转化漏斗、库存周转率、客服响应时效等指标。曾有个项目通过实时预警功能,帮助客户将缺货导致的订单流失率降低了27%。
客户报告场景:面向外部合作伙伴的数据展示,需要平衡专业性与易读性。为某广告代理设计的客户看板中,我们采用"总-分"结构:首屏展示整体投放效果,次屏提供可下钻的渠道细分数据,客户续约率因此提升15%。
在启动任何工具前,必须完成"5W1H"分析框架。最近为某连锁餐饮集团做咨询时,发现他们之前失败的看板项目根本原因是需求模糊。我们通过以下问题梳理实现了逆转:
优秀的数据看板都在讲述一个商业故事。我的方法论是采用"问题-证据-结论"结构:
在某快消品项目中,这种叙事结构帮助销售团队将数据分析时间缩短60%,更多精力投入到策略制定。
现代企业数据往往分散在多个系统(ERP、CRM、网站分析等)。建议采用"黄金数据源"原则:
典型的数据整合架构:
sql复制-- 示例:创建数据视图
CREATE VIEW sales_dashboard AS
SELECT
o.order_date,
r.region_name,
p.category,
SUM(o.amount) AS gross_sales,
SUM(o.profit) AS net_profit
FROM orders o
JOIN products p ON o.product_id = p.id
JOIN regions r ON o.region_id = r.id
GROUP BY 1,2,3
数据清洗占看板项目70%的工作量。我总结的"DECA"流程:
Detect(检测):识别缺失值、异常值、重复记录
Evaluate(评估):判断问题数据的处理方式
Clean(清洗):执行标准化操作
python复制# 示例:使用Pandas处理异常值
df['sales'] = df['sales'].apply(
lambda x: x if (x >= 0) & (x <= 1e6) else np.nan)
df['sales'].fillna(df['sales'].median(), inplace=True)
Audit(审计):验证数据质量
重要提示:永远保留原始数据副本,所有清洗操作应通过脚本实现可复现
OLAP(在线分析处理)是看板的核心技术。通过"钻取/切片/切块"操作实现多角度分析:
某电商案例中,我们通过下钻发现:
基础指标往往不足以支撑深度分析。必须构建衍生指标体系:
| 指标类型 | 计算公式 | 业务意义 |
|---|---|---|
| 滚动周增长率 | (本周-上周)/上周 | 消除周末效应看趋势 |
| 同店销售额 | 仅统计开业满1年的门店 | 排除新店干扰的同比比较 |
| 购物篮渗透率 | 关联商品销售次数/总交易次数 | 评估交叉销售效果 |
excel复制// 示例:Excel中计算移动平均
=AVERAGE(OFFSET(B2,0,0,-7,1)) // 7日移动平均
根据Stephen Few的可视化理论,图表选择取决于数据类型:
颜色使用原则:
FineBI支持多种数据连接方式:
建模关键步骤:
javascript复制// 示例:创建利润率计算字段
SUM_AGG(利润)/SUM_AGG(销售额)
动态参数应用:
sql复制CASE WHEN 地区 IN (${region_param})
THEN 销售额 ELSE 0 END
自定义地图:
预警条件格式:
大型看板常见性能问题及解决方案:
| 问题现象 | 可能原因 | 解决方案 |
|---|---|---|
| 加载缓慢 | 数据量过大 | 启用增量刷新/聚合预计算 |
| 交互卡顿 | 复杂计算表达式 | 优化公式/使用缓存结果 |
| 并发访问失败 | 数据库连接限制 | 配置连接池/错峰刷新策略 |
根据我的实施经验,有效的培训应分层进行:
培训材料应包括:
建立看板健康度评估体系:
某制造客户通过每月优化会议,使看板采纳率在半年内从45%提升至82%
核心模块:
特殊设计:
合规要求:
特色指标:
数据特性:
可视化挑战:
过度设计:添加不必要的3D效果和动画
指标孤岛:各图表间缺乏逻辑关联
缺乏对比:仅展示当期绝对值
更新故障:依赖人工维护导致数据过期
权限混乱:敏感数据未做访问控制
动态注释:
javascript复制// 根据数据值自动生成注释文本
IF([销售额]>1000000, "创纪录表现!", "需提升")
智能预警:
个性化推送:
在最近一个项目中,通过实施动态注释系统,使报告解读时间平均缩短了40%
某科技公司通过集成协作功能,使跨部门数据讨论效率提升35%
最高阶的数据看板不再是被动展示工具,而成为主动决策助手。通过结合机器学习模型,可以实现:
在供应链优化项目中,这种智能看板帮助客户将库存周转率提高了22%,同时降低缺货率15%